According to our databases, most users of this financial (Bank of Nova Scotia) live within 25KM. 6KM within range, this financial is one of the most visited by our users. The communication between the financial and city (Pelee Island) are acceptable. this financial is located in 580 Bayfield Street
Barrie, ON L4M 5A2
Canada, in the city of Pelee Island.
Rate this college (Bank of Nova Scotia) so that other users know to choose a good option.